  • GeForce 830M has 65% more power consumption, than GeForce MX350.
  • GeForce 830M is connected by PCIe 3.0 x8, and GeForce MX350 uses PCIe 3.0 x16 interface.
  • GeForce 830M and GeForce MX350 have maximum RAM of 2 GB.
  • Both cards are used in Laptops.
  • GeForce 830M is build with Maxwell architecture, and GeForce MX350 - with Pascal.
  • Core clock speed of GeForce MX350 is 325 MHz higher, than GeForce 830M.
  • GeForce 830M is manufactured by 28 nm process technology, and GeForce MX350 - by 14 nm process technology.
  • Memory clock speed of GeForce MX350 is 5200 MHz higher, than GeForce 830M.
